I agree with Sonya. Look for some rabbit breeders in your area. Those that raise meat rabbits will probably be more expensive but if you can find rabbitrys of show breeders you will find that they have to cull over 50% of the offspring because there isn't justification for keeping anything that isn't show or show breeder quality. You may get 1 keeper out of 20 babies. When I was raising show rabbits I sold some of the culls for pets but the rest became either meat or were sold to reptile or raptor groups, mostly raptor rescue. These don't usually command a huge price. I think I got anywhere from $3-5 each but that was small bunnies. The larger they need to be the more that is invested in food and care so the price would go up commensurate with the bunnies size!
